Antique store remodeling in San Francisco.
|
| The client has a two story antique shop in downtown San Francisco. He decided to remodel the facade of the building, install few skylights and remodel the restroom to comply with disability codes. He didn't have any existing plans for the property, so we had to do measurements for the whole store. After existing floor plans were made, we start on a facade and restroom changes. The set of plans included nine pages and Title 24 calculations ($250). The project cost was $2650 including measurements and Title 24. |
